Food and Nutritional Security in States of India
Details
Indian economy and population have been subjected to varied food production, availability and distribution throughout recorded history. While three have been abundance of food and resources have attracted people from other nations to explore, exploit, govern and settle in the country. There have also been times when Indian soil, climate and famines have taken away seasonal practices lives and led holds of people leave the country in search of food. The nature and significance of food security cannot be determined in any way less important for human settlement than this.
